2006 F&B Association Award Honorees Demonstrate Distinguished Service And Success

The Food and Beverage Association of America is proud to announce that it will host the 50th Annual Ken Strong Memorial Scholarship Fund Awards Dinner on Friday, May 5th at the New York Marriott Marquis. The Association will be honoring three most important leaders in the hospitality industry for their longtime dedication and commitment to the hospitality community.

The officers and members of the Association are proud to honor Joseph V. Cozza, Executive Director of Catering at the New York Marriott Marquis; and David Adler, founder and CEO of BiZBash Media, as Hospitality Industry Professionals of the Year 2006, and Fedele Miranda, General Manager of Peerless Merchants, as Purveyor of the Year.

Proceeds from this event will go the Association's scholarship programs, as the future of our industry lies with today's students. Furthermore, The Food and Beverage Association of America is proud to continue and participate in many other charitable venues in the New York metropolitan area for the betterment of our society.
